September 1, 2009. Mexican Health Officials Predict 1 Million H1N1 Cases for Winter
SOURCE: | Corporate Risk International |
Health officials report that there could be as many as one million H1N1 flu cases in the country during this upcoming winter, according to report on August 31st. Authorities say there are some 80 to 100 cases reported daily and there have been some 184 deaths thus far. Authorities have reportedly prepared plans to deal with the expected increase in cases, including possible school closures.
